E-biker arrested on stolen property charges

A routine traffic stop by Windsor police has resulted in a 30-year-old man facing several charges.

Police said a patrol officer conducted a traffic stop shortly before 1:30 p.m. Wednesday on an e-biker who was travelling without the required helmet.

Upon checking the operator's background it was revealed that he had outstanding warrants. A further investigation uncovered an undisclosed amount of U.S. cash, which was found to be counterfeit.

Additional property found on the man was revealed to have been stolen and he was arrested without incident, according to Constable Talya Natyshak.

Dawson Challoner of Windsor has been charged with possession of counterfeit money, plus two counts of possession of stolen property. These charges have not been proven in court.
